1.前言
目前具有 USB 供電 (PD) 功能的 USB Type-C? 端口正在成為為單節和多節電池供電設備充電的標準端口。
無線揚聲器、移動電源和電動工具等應用已經從專有充電端口、傳統 USB 端口和桶形插孔端口過渡到標準化 USB PD 端口。
USB PD 為快速方便的充電提供了一種通用的替代方案,用戶無需隨身攜帶多個適配器或電纜——幫助設計工程師創建更小的應用程序,充電速度更快,組件更少。
隨著這些應用功能變得更加豐富、緊湊和耗電,有必要以更小的解決方案尺寸提供更多的功率。同時,消費者開始期待在他們的新設備上使用 USB Type-C。但是,對于產品開發人員來說,實現 USB PD 端口歷來頗具挑戰性。
2.簡化設計方案
在過去,添加 USB PD 端口需要非常深入地了解 USB 規范以及大量的固件和硬件開發工作。幾個不同的組件需要協同工作以促進 USB PD 支持。
為充電應用完成 USB PD 端口所需的兩個主要集成電路 (IC) 是 USB PD 控制器 IC 和電池充電器 IC。這些 IC 通常彼此獨立運行,并且無法在沒有外部微控制器 (MCU) 大量參與的情況下在系統中工作。
此限制還需要 MCU 固件開發,以便將 USB PD 端口上發生的事件傳達給電池充電器 IC。例如,一旦 USB PD 控制器 IC 在 USB Type-C 端口(或新的電源合同)上協商新的電壓和電流,微控制器需要從 USB PD 控制器讀回此信息,然后更新電池充電器的充電電流和充電電壓基于連接到 USB PD 端口的內容。此外,從 USB PD 端口為外部設備供電需要 USB PD 控制器、MCU 和電池充電器之間的額外通信。
將 MCU 編程為 USB PD 控制器和電池充電器之間的接口通常不是添加 USB PD 時所需的唯一固件開發。典型的 PD 控制器 IC 需要某種形式的固件開發來配置 PD 控制器行為本身,例如一起編譯一些代碼或腳本功能。必須配置 USB PD 控制器,以確保 PD 控制器上的設置滿足您的系統要求,包括系統可以吸收哪些電壓和電流以及可以提供哪些電壓和電流。
3.使用 TI 控制器和充電器進行設計
為了幫助簡化用于高達 45 W 的電池供電應用的 USB PD 端口的設計,TPS25750 USB PD 控制器增加了 I?2?C 主機支持,以直接控制 BQ25792 電池充電器,而無需外部 MCU 的任何干預。TPS25750 USB PD 控制器將根據 USB PD 端口上的功率協商,通過 I?2?C自動更新 BQ25792 的充電參數。因此,現在不需要外部 MCU,您無需開發固件即可為電池供電應用添加 USB PD 端口。
使用 TPS25750 的基于 Web 的圖形用戶界面 (GUI) 配置 USB PD 端口行為需要回答幾個關于您的 USB PD 端口需要支持什么的多項選擇題——不需要復雜的腳本、代碼編譯或固件開發。這不僅降低了材料清單成本;它允許您在不具備有關該技術的深入專業知識的情況下添加 USB PD。
TPS25750 和 BQ25792 集成了電池充電器和 USB PD 控制器所需的所有電源路徑。圖 1 突出顯示了這些設備如何為高達 45 W 的電池供電系統簡化 USB PD 端口的實施。當這兩個 IC 一起使用時,USB PD 端口將能夠支持雙向供電,提供源電源和接收電源,因此當系統連接到筆記本電腦、智能手機、耳機或交流適配器等外部設備時,使系統能夠從 USB PD 端口充電或充電。
除了這些系統實施優勢之外,TPS25750D 和 BQ25792 還集成了系統的所有場效應晶體管 (FET),無需外部 MCU,使您能夠實現非常小的解決方案尺寸。與基于 MCU 的非集成 USB PD 電池充電實施相比,典型的系統解決方案尺寸約為 150 mm?2。使用 TPS2570 和 BQ25792 時,可以實現大約 55 mm?2的系統解決方案尺寸。
圖 1:TPS25750D 和 BQ25792 USB PD 電池充電器實施
圖 2 突出顯示了基于 MCU 的 USB PD 控制器和帶有外部 FET 的電池充電器,適用于需要高功率充電和系統功率通常大于 45 W 的應用。對于大于 45 W 的應用,請考慮將 TPS25750 控制器與 BQ25731 充電器配對。
圖 2:基于 MCU 的非集成解決方案
表 1 比較了基于集成和非集成 MCU 的解決方案的 USB PD 充電。
? |
USB PD 電池充電器實現高達 45 W |
基于 MCU 的非集成 USB PD 電池充電器實現 |
外部單片機 |
不需要;TPS25750 是用于電池充電器的 I?2?C 主機控制器 |
必需的;?USB PD 控制器和電池充電器獨立運行 |
固件開發 |
不需要;該系統可通過問答 GUI 進行配置 |
必需的;?需要通過 MCU 與 USB PD 控制器和電池充電器接口 |
系統電源路徑 |
所有系統電源路徑都集成在 USB PD 控制器和電池充電器中 |
外部 FET 是完成解決方案所必需的 |
溶液大小 |
約 55 毫米2 |
約 150 毫米2 |
表 1:集成與非集成 USB PD 電池充電器實施比較
隨著法規推動通用充電器的出現,使用 USB PD 進行充電的趨勢最近變得更加緊迫。使用 TPS25750 和 BQ25792 更新您的系統以從 USB PD 充電現在比以往任何時候都更容易,使您能夠遷移到最新的通用充電連接器,同時不影響解決方案尺寸。
?
這里還沒有內容,您有什么問題嗎?
電子電路資源推薦
- SOT封裝.PcbLib
來源:下載中心
- 圖解LED應用從入門到精通
來源:下載中心
- 電子設計從零開始
來源:大學堂
- 是德兩分鐘導師系列課程第一季
來源:大學堂
- PCB板基礎知識講解
來源:電路圖
- 電阻的串聯、并聯及混聯電路介紹及作用
來源:電路圖
推薦帖子 最新更新時間:2025-04-05 08:09
- 一個電池放電四塊電池切換電路
- 我這里涉及到一個四塊鋰電池切換問題,主要用在設備上,四塊電池從1-4,第一塊電池開始放電,當第一塊電池放電結束后,其他電池依次放電,這個是一個切換電路,一塊電池的電壓是21.6V,結束工作的切換電壓是14V,這個不涉及到功率問題,只是切換,但是我的電路目前存在問題。請幫我看一看
icehippo
電源技術
- 【LPC54100】+LPC-LINK更新教程以及一些開發資料
- 由于本人習慣用KEIL所以得把LPC_LINK跟新成CMSISI-DAP才能方便后期調試。由于以前沒怎么搞過這個所以搞得頭大啊,所以寫些東西希望以后的孩子可以輕松點。 1、首先在官網上下載LCT這個工具。 2、打開LPCLink-Config-Tool,將開
908508455a
NXP MCU
- vxworks與simulink實時仿真,如何加載模型.lo?(急求)
- rtw編譯后生成.lo模型,各位大俠如何load模型.lo?。坑胠oadModule載入總是報未定義符號類型……,有參考文獻指出要啟動rt_main()函數,手動在shell里面可以用sp啟動進行實時仿真,但是想實現自動鏈編啟動卻不行,也進行了rt_main的外部聲明,但是不能找
andyye1630
實時操作系統RTOS
- AD627識別真假的方法
- AD627識別真假的方法,通過測量,檢查你買的是真貨還是贗品,這個挺有意思的。 http://download.eeworld.com.cn/detail/zhangcx/551778 AD627識別真假的方法
快羊加鞭
下載中心專版
- PIC 8位單片機的分類和特點
- 美國Microchip公司推出的PIC單片機系列產品,首先采用了RISC結構的嵌入式微控制器,其高速度、低電壓、低功耗、大電流LCD驅動能力和低價位OTP技術等都體現出單片機產業的新趨勢?,F在PIC系列單片機在世界單片機市場的份額排名中已逐年升位,尤其在8位單片機市場,據稱已從1
zhaozilong
Microchip MCU
- TI RS-485 十大設計技巧
- 轉自deyisupport 在TI經常遇到這樣的問題:在使用 RS-485 進行設計時,是否有一些技巧或訣竅需要掌握?為此,我們總結了使用 RS-485 時需要記住的一系列綜合而全面的重要準則。 如何應用…… 1) 使用 圖 A 確定最大線纜長度 2) 使用
maylove
模擬與混合信號
- NXP LPC1768寶馬開發板第13章SPI (SD卡刷圖)
- Rayeager PX2的GPIO控制范例
- 【曬樣片】+用LED 矩陣管理器(TPS92661-Q1)
- 玩轉IP core
- 【Atmel SAM R21創意大賽周計劃】第6周 USB CDC例程現象似乎不對呀
- 沒有棋子的LED棋盤!
- STM32F407關于ST-link下載的問題
- (FPGA~2014-07-03)阻塞賦值“=”與非阻塞賦值“<=”你懂了嗎?
- 28305的EPWM模塊詳解
- 射頻電路設計——理論與應用(國外電子與通信教材)
- TM4C123GH6PM
- 鏈表實現類似qq好友分組結構
- 飯卡修復記
- 關于PIC下載器的求助
- Stellaris系列實驗例程——Keil實驗例程
- 【求助】請問CC2540 怎么在廣播里面廣播出mac地址???
- 迎新年:ADI第九期下載有獎獲獎名單揭曉
- 【TI首屆低功耗設計大賽】+ 系統軟件設計
- 出一個全新艾睿合眾SEED-EXP430F5529 USB開發板!
- CCS3.3編譯器問題